Yes he does. This is because Nat Field of the 16th century has the Bubonic Plague otherwise known as "Black Death" which is impossibly incurable at that time. His namesake, Nat Field, of modern times is an actor of Shakespeare's plays. Somehow, both Nat's switch places and 16th century Nat's bubonic plague is easily cured while modern Nat performs a play with Shakespeare who becomes almost like his missing father figure in his life. The King of Shadows by Susan Cooper is a genius idea of a story and it is filled with action and adventure. :)
